CVE-2022-26806: Microsoft Office Graphics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

Microsoft Office Graphics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

Plain-English summary

CVE-2022-26806 is a Microsoft Office Graphics remote code execution issue. In business terms, a user opening crafted Office-related content could allow code execution on their workstation. The provided data rates it high severity, but it does not show active exploitation.

Executive priority

Treat as a high-priority workstation patching item, especially where Office documents are routinely received from external parties. There is no source-backed evidence of active exploitation in the provided bundle, so urgency should focus on timely remediation rather than emergency response.

Technical view

The supplied CVSS vector is 7.8 high: local attack vector, low complexity, no privileges required, user interaction required, unchanged scope, and high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act. The affected product listed is Microsoft 365 Apps for Enterprise version 16.0.1.

Likely exposure

Exposure is most relevant for endpoints running the listed Microsoft 365 Apps for Enterprise version. The source bundle does not identify other affected products, deployment configurations, or server-side exposure.

Exploitation context

The source bundle does not support active exploitation: KEV is false and exploit maturity is marked unproven. The CVSS vector indicates user interaction is required, so phishing or document-opening scenarios are the main concern, but no exploit details are provided.
